Hermione Riley

Executive Assistant To CEO & CFO at Harding+

Hermione Riley is an experienced Executive Assistant currently serving the CEO and CFO at Harding+, the leading cruise retailer recognized for simplifying and enhancing the cruise experience. Prior to this role starting in January 2023, Hermione worked at Twinings as a PA to the Director of Supply Operations for the UK & India, with a substantial tenure that lasted from June 2017 to January 2023. Earlier roles include Office Manager and PA at Radish Investments and Property Manager at Campden Estates Limited, where responsibilities included managing a portfolio of high-end properties. Hermione also gained initial experience as an Administrative Secretary at Free-Time Business Services. Education includes a BSc Hons in Rural Environmental Management and Marketing from Newcastle University, completed in 1999 after attending Queen Margaret's School in York.

Harding+

We are the cruise industry’s first choice retail partner, and holder of the ‘Cruise Retailer of the Year’ title for the last 2 years from the DFNI Frontier Awards. Our purpose lies in making every cruise better, from a specialist understanding of guest dwell time and how to work with it, to unparalleled levels of data and insights gathered from ships across the globe, best in class marketing and merchandising skills, and a global logistics model that means we literally never miss the boat. We are champions of sustainability, pursuing BCorp status and investing in significant carbon reduction and efficiency projects across our business. Everything is underpinned by our ‘Quaternity’ model, which is our partnership between cruise line partners, brand partners, guest insights and our Harding+ expertise to ensure every ship’s retail model is bespoke, relevant and designed to land impact and success for all parties. With central hubs in Bristol, Miami and Sydney we enable a collaborative approach like no other. We currently work with 16 cruise brand partners across the globe, including more than 90 cruise ships and 300+ forward-thinking shops on board. We employ over 200 team members landside and over 1,200 shipboard, meaning we can justifiably champion our status as diversity and inclusion champions, helping to live the “+” in our name at all touchpoints of how we operate.
